Output 45ace8aa0b134136d0f4b308e2d584eed93b9ecd7e9ceeaf788239fcd57714c5:0

value
6836602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87d6fc3dfb4115835ac28ce42378ffd0c129fc3 OP_EQUAL
address
3Ky7LPwhJR8PzGvBFDNLpzTUxe6bQXZgcZ
transaction
45ace8aa0b134136d0f4b308e2d584eed93b9ecd7e9ceeaf788239fcd57714c5
spent
true